## Configuration

Bristlefin retries failed exports automatically. Defaults: 3 attempts, exponential backoff, 10-minute cap. Override via `RETRY_MAX` and `RETRY_BASE_MS` in `.env` at the repo root. Exports go to the Copperdune bucket; no retry runs without valid credentials. Copy `.env.example`, adjust the retry values if needed, and append the export token on its own line.

vault entry, kagep-yajeg: COURIER_KEY5=da097

# Tilework Rendering — Environments

Tilework is the template rendering service behind the Orvale storefront. Three environments: dev, perf, prod. Perf exists solely for rendering benchmarks — it mirrors prod hardware but disables caching layers so regressions surface early. New team members: run load tests only against perf, never prod. Template compile timeouts and worker counts differ per environment, which explains most "it's slow locally" confusion. The perf environment's current settings are listed below.

deployment values, tafof-taduf:
pelius:
  pin: 6508
  tenant: praiel
  seal: seal_4e33a2f4
  metrics_host: metrics.pelius.plorvagrid.corp
  standby_team: druix
  escalation: juldor-norius
  nonce: 5db598

**Q: Why does the Fleetfoot chip reader emit duplicate crossings?**

Each timing mat has overlapping antenna zones, so a runner can register twice within 300ms. The dedupe window in `crossing_filter.go` collapses these; reviewers should confirm any change keeps the window configurable per race. Edge case: relay exchanges legitimately produce near-simultaneous reads. Test fixtures and the dedupe spec live on the page below.

runbook for baguf-bawip: https://jira.qorvelsys.internal/pages/pages/pages/browse/1853

## Pricing Experiment: Fernbright Tickets

Heads up for the security pass: the ticket-pricing experiment stores variant assignments and price overrides in a separate schema, write access limited to the experiment service account. Check that audit triggers are enabled before sign-off. To poke around the experiment tables yourself, connect with the string below.

replica DSN, yahog-kawig: redis://istox_svc:um@db-8a67.halixforge.test:5432/frawyn